RB433 - Connection Problems with Ethernet Adapter

I have a RB433 which is giving me some trouble. We had a minor thunderstorm the other day and I did manage to unplug the power source from the Wall socket. I did forget to unplug the RJ45 cables though.

Scenario Explanation:

  1. RB Boots up through POE unit successfully
  2. When connecting the “Data In” port of the POE unit onto my Nettop’s Ethernet Adapter, it does not confirm that a cable has been plugged in
    (Can’t connect to Winbox)
  3. Remove “Data In” Cable from Nettop’s Ethernet port and plug into NetGear DGN2200M DSL Router
  4. Plug a LAN Cable from NetGear router directly onto Nettop’s Ethernet Port
  5. Able to connect to Winbox and work without any issues

Other Information:
I Use Static IP’s
I’ve plugged the “Data In” cable onto a different PC with the same results
I’ve used a different Fly-lead as a subsitute for the “Data In” cable
Uninstalled and Re-Installed Adapter
Tried another POE Supply

Any ideas as to why this would happen? I find it very strange that the connection to the Winbox works fine when using a DSL router as a medium.

Double-check the IP settings of both the RB and your Nettop: make sure that both are (still) static and on the same subnet. If either has switched to use DHCP, you might be able to connect with WInbox via MAC, but not by IP, without a DHCP server like the NetGear.
